摘要The control poles for driving machine in the built and building nuclear power station are made of thick wall 1Cr13 tubes which all depend on overseas importation. With the fast development of domestic nuclear power stations and the need with coming export, as one of the key parts of driving machines, the 1Cr13 tubes used as control poles should be finished in our country. By optimizing the contents of C, Ni, Cr, H, O and N etc., and adjusting the technology of cold rolling, the cracking problem of 1Cr13 tube as control poles during machining is avoided and favorable surface quality is also obtained. The mechanical properties of finished tubes reach the technical request after proper heat-treatment.
